The main objective of our work is to design and develop innovative phosphate materials in powder and ceramic form for environmental applications. Subsequently, the photocatalytic and photoluminescent properties of these materials will be studied in order to ensure their efficiency in environmental applications, i.e. the degradation of organic pollutants in aqueous medium or the detection of radiations or dangerous gases in the atmosphere.
